Current Events and Coverage
As of 2023, BBC Rugby has been actively covering significant tournaments, including the ongoing Rugby World Cup, featuring matches from around the globe. The broadcaster airs live games, highlights, making-of documentaries, and pre-and post-match discussions, bringing fans closer to the action. Specific stories focus on star players, impactful matches, and in-depth analysis of team performances, ensuring viewers remain informed about their favourite teams and players.
Moreover, BBC Radio 5 Live has emerged as a significant outlet for rugby enthusiasts, offering live commentary and engaging discussions. The radio broadcasts have gained increased listenership, particularly during key match days, enhancing the overall experience for fans unable to view games live on television.
